ASOne is not Connecting to Zoom
If you are experiencing problems connecting to the Zoom meeting with ASOne, try these simple troubleshooting options:
- Did you join the Zoom meeting before setting up your ASOne Zoom recording?
- Zoom must be opened before connecting an ASOne Zoom recording session.
- Is the password embedded in your Zoom link?
- The password must be embedded in the Zoom link. It will look something like this: https://voicescript-ai.zoom.us/j/85880747743?pwd=bpmMPeQPPYH2MaDjqJxXvCZDvxnjfa.1
- Are you the host of the Zoom meeting?
- You must be the host of the Zoom meeting to grant ASOne permission to record.
- If there is a videographer present in the Zoom meeting, chances are that they are the host. You can ask them to grant permission to ASOne for recording when the pop-up window appears.
If you are in compliance with all of the above, perhaps the issue is that ASOne has connected to the Zoom meeting, but you are just getting the spinning blue arrow. If that is the case, try one of these:
- First, is your mic muted? Please try unmuting your microphone. The Zoom bot has to detect at least one person on the meeting and if your mic is muted, you are not being detected.
- The second cause could be that Zoom cloud recording was set to automatically record the Zoom meeting to the cloud by the provider of the meeting link and you paused that recording.
The Zoom recording cannot be in a paused state while ASOne is attempting to connect and record using the AutoScript Zoom bot. The solution is to un-pause the Zoom cloud recording, allow ASOne to connect to the meeting and start recording, pause the ASOne recording and then pause the Zoom cloud recording.
If none of the above helped to resolve your issue, please reach out to our support team for assistance, or revert to a Hybrid recording option.
